Posting a Job
As an employer, finding the right employees is crucial. There are many on-line sites that allow you to advertise your job opportunities. The site of choice is SaskNetWork. This site has the largest number of job listings for the Saskatoon area and there is no charge for posting jobs. All jobs on SaskNetWork are uploaded to the National Job Bank of Human Resources Development Canada, so a large audience will see them.

Posting your job on SaskNetWork is an easy process and shouldn't take more than 15 minutes. The first step is to call the Canada-Saskatchewan Career and Employment Services Job Order Line at (306) 933-5859 and register as an Internet Job Bank user. They will give you a username and password to access the system.

Once you have been registered as a user, visit the job order posting page on www.sasknetwork.gov.sk.ca, and scroll down to the bottom. Enter your username and password, and click the login button. Once you have identified yourself to the system, you may enter the information about the job. If you require online help, just look for the question mark boxes.
